Javra Software is seeking a highly talented PHP Developer with Symfony experience who will be responsible for creating and enhancing application build in Pimcore. You will be working in various internal and external projects with different level of complexities and challenges.
Roles and Responsibilities
Your responsibilities will includes ( but are not limited to ):
- Build efficient, and reusable modules/application using the leading Symfony Framework.
- Interface with customer and internal teams to gather requirements and develop solutions using Pimcore.
- Designing, coding, and implementing scalable applications like Webportal, Dashboards and Digital Asset Management using PIMcore.
- Development and concept design for digital product information management and its integration with other e-commerce platforms.
- Participate in strategic technical planning for product building and be in communication with the respective stakeholders.
- Solve complex performance problems and architectural challenges.
- Focus on application performance and scalability to provide the best possible customer experience.
- Do improvement, bug fixes and customization of existing application.
Requirements
- Bachelor in computer science or similar IT related field.
- Professional experience in building scalable web applications.
- Should have strong proficiency in object-oriented programming (OOP) , MVC architectural pattern & PHP Symfony framework.
- Must have good understanding of ecommerce/webportal, digital asset management and product information management.
- Understanding of a PIMcore architecture, data structure and experience working with Pimcore application is a plus.
- Minimum 4+ years of experience with software development using PHP & Mysql.
- Minimum 2 years of experience working with PHP-Symfony framework.
- Should be proficient in PHP, HTML5, JavaScript and JQuery.
- Should have prior experience working with Multiple application integration and Web Services.
- PHP/PIMCore certification is a plus.
- Working understanding of Git and common SCM platforms (e.g. BitBucket, Github, GitLab).
- Experience working with MySQL, MSSQL and/or MongoDB databases.
- Strong communication skills and the ability to work in a fast-paced, dynamic team environment.
- Experience with Magento is an emphatic plus.